About the 2023 Cadillac XT5

1st generation XT5 (2017-2024 U.S. model cycle), in the post-2020 refresh period; 2023 is the fourth model year after that update.

Cadillac positions the XT5 as a stylish two-row midsize luxury SUV that balances comfort, cargo usefulness, and easy everyday drivability. It sits between the smaller XT4 and the three-row XT6, giving buyers a roomy cabin and generous cargo space without moving to a larger family SUV. The core draw is relaxed daily use: a quiet ride, straightforward infotainment, upscale trim choices, and a broad set of standard safety features rather than an aggressively sporty personality.

The Luxury trim is the straightforward version, with a turbo four-cylinder engine, an 8-inch touchscreen, w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, and a broad set of driver-assistance features. Premium Luxury adds leather seating, upgraded 14-speaker Bose audio, navigation, memory settings, and more convenience features. Sport is the more athletic model, pairing a V6 and all-wheel drive with an adjustable suspension, Brembo brakes, and dark exterior trim.

What changed, by category

Tech
Embedded navigation with the 14-speaker Bose audio system became standard on Premium Luxury and Sport; navigation had been optional on those trims for 2022.

Frequently asked questions

What is the biggest change to the 2023 Cadillac XT5?

The biggest change is standard embedded navigation on the Premium Luxury and Sport trims. The rest of the XT5 lineup is largely unchanged from 2022.

Was the 2023 Cadillac XT5 redesigned?

No, the 2023 Cadillac XT5 was not redesigned. It continues the first-generation design and the updates introduced for 2020, with only a minor trim-specific equipment change for 2023.

Which 2023 Cadillac XT5 trims have standard navigation?

The 2023 Premium Luxury and Sport trims have standard embedded navigation paired with a 14-speaker Bose audio system. Navigation is not standard on the Luxury trim.

Did the 2023 Cadillac XT5 get new engines?

No, the 2023 Cadillac XT5 did not get new engines. Luxury and Premium Luxury retain the 2.0-liter turbo four-cylinder, while Sport retains the 3.6-liter V6; every trim uses a nine-speed automatic transmission.

Is the 2023 Cadillac XT5 meaningfully different from the 2022 model?

No, the 2023 XT5 is not meaningfully different overall. Its main advantage over the 2022 model is standard navigation on Premium Luxury and Sport; the design, engines, transmission, and core safety equipment carry over.
